2. What is a Video Otoscope?
A **video otoscope** is a device designed for examining the ear canal and eardrum. Unlike traditional otoscopes, which rely on simple optics and a light source, video otoscopes incorporate a camera that displays real-time images on an LCD screen. This feature significantly enhances visualization and allows for more precise diagnostics.
The setup generally includes an adjustable camera, a light source, and a high-resolution LCD display, which together create a comprehensive view of the ear's internal structures.
3. Benefits of Using a Video Otoscope with LCD Screen
3.1 Enhanced Visualization and Clarity
One of the primary advantages of a video otoscope is its ability to provide **high-definition images** of the ear canal and tympanic membrane. The clarity offered by the LCD screen allows clinicians to detect issues such as earwax buildup, infections, or structural abnormalities with greater accuracy than traditional otoscopes.
The detailed imaging capabilities lead to more informed decisions, ultimately improving patient outcomes.
3.2 Improved Patient Engagement
Video otoscopes foster **better communication** between healthcare providers and patients. By allowing patients to see their ear condition in real-time, providers can educate them about their health issues more effectively. This transparency can alleviate anxiety, as patients can actively participate in the discussion regarding their treatment options.
Additionally, visual aids can bridge knowledge gaps, making it easier for patients to understand complex medical terminologies.
3.3 Increased Efficiency in Diagnosis
Time is of the essence in medical diagnostics. Video otoscopes streamline the examination process by providing immediate feedback on ear health. Clinicians can make quicker diagnoses, reducing the time spent on each patient without compromising care quality.
Moreover, the ability to capture and record images allows for efficient documentation and follow-up care, enhancing overall practice efficiency.
4. Advanced Features of Video Otoscopes
4.1 Image Capture and Recording Capabilities
Modern video otoscopes come equipped with **image capture and video recording** capabilities. These features enable clinicians to document examinations, providing a valuable resource for future consultations or referrals. The stored images can be shared with other specialists for a second opinion, ensuring comprehensive patient care.
This ability to maintain detailed records also aids in monitoring the progression of ear conditions over time.
4.2 Real-Time Monitoring and Analysis
The functionality of real-time visualization allows clinicians to conduct immediate analysis during examinations. This capability is especially beneficial in urgent care settings where timely decision-making can impact patient outcomes.
By leveraging real-time monitoring, healthcare professionals can swiftly identify and address any ear health concerns.
5. Applications of Video Otoscopes in Medical Practice
5.1 Use in Pediatrics
In pediatric medicine, video otoscopes are invaluable tools for ear examinations. Children may be apprehensive about traditional otoscopy methods due to the discomfort associated with inserting instruments into their ears. The visual element provided by video otoscopes can create a more child-friendly environment, easing anxiety and promoting cooperation during examinations.
Furthermore, pediatricians can use the visual data to educate parents about their child's ear health, fostering a collaborative approach to treatment.
5.2 Importance in ENT Specialties
In the field of Ear, Nose, and Throat (ENT) medicine, video otoscopes are essential for **detailed ear examinations**. ENT specialists rely on these devices to diagnose a wide array of conditions, from common infections to rare anatomical anomalies.
The ability to visualize and analyze ear structures with precision allows ENT professionals to develop tailored treatment plans, enhancing the quality of care provided to their patients.
